What should I see in Palmer Lake?
If you’d like to find some ways to explore Palmer Lake while making good use of your travel budget, this destination has lots to offer. Spots where you’ll find the natural beauty on display include Palmer Lake Regional Recreation Area, Glen Park, and Greenland Open Space. Another place not to be missed is Palmer Lake Library.
